  • I always choose Swords for the hero because he looks a bit silly carrying anything else. Spear and Boomerangs might actually be more useful though. I've done Scythes with Yangus before because Steal Sickle but it very rarely yields results. Axe has some good skills but the Conqueror's Axe is his weakest final weapon and those execution skills aren't the greatest either.

  • I use magic so much with Jessica that I also pair her with staves and $εχ appeal. Whips can be useful too though--they steal hp for her and paralyse enemies. But her best whip costs 200,000 tokens at the casino! I'd rather not go with whips. Since I'm not giving Angelo the Metal King Sword I'd give him bows--but just like Jessica I only cast spells with him late in the game so staves are best.

  • It's true no matter what you pick you could manage to get the job done, but certain skill paths are just more useful than others. Jessica's Knife skills for example, she learns a bunch of poison and instant kill moves which aren't helpful against bosses or large crowds. You'll just end up casting spells with her.

  • I forgot that in the 3DS version of Dragon Quest VIII your HP/MP refills when you level up--meaning it won't be as important to have loads of MP stored up for Jessica and Angelo when you're stuck in a dungeon. So giving them something other than staves in this version might be best. (I really don't want to save up 200,000 casino tokens for that whip tho.)
